And food safety issues have been rampant at the chain. Chipotle’s wholesome, health-forward reputation took a major downturn when a series of foodborne illness outbreaks caused by Norovirus, Salmonella, and E. coli sickened more than 1,100 people between 2015 and 2018.

What virus did Chipotle have?

Norovirus
2017 Outbreak of Norovirus at Chipotle Mexican Grill, Sterling, VA —The Loudoun County, VA, Health Department reported that more than 135 people were sickened after eating food from the Chipotle Mexican Grill at 21031 Tripleseven Road in Sterling, VA. Two ill patrons tested positive for norovirus.

How many people get sick from Chipotle?

In July 2018, nearly 650 people got food poisoning after dining at a Chipotle restaurant in Powell, Ohio. The outbreak that caused diarrhea and abdominal pain was tied to bacteria that proliferates when food is not kept at proper temperatures, prosecutors said.
